Read all instruction.
Before using check that the voltage of wall outlet corresponds to rated voltage
marked on the rating plate.
This appliance has been incorporated with a polarized plug.
To protect against fire, electric shock and injury to persons do not immerse
cord, plug, in water or other liquid.
Remove plug from wall outlet before cleaning and when not in use. Allow
appliance cool down completely before taking off, attaching components or
before cleaning.
Do not operate any appliance with a damaged cord or plug or after the
appliance malfunctions, or is dropped or damaged in any manner. Return
appliance to the nearest authorized service facility for examination, repair or
electrical or mechanical adjustment.
The use of accessory attachments not recommended by the appliance manu-
facturer may result in fire, electric shock or injury to persons.
Place appliance on flat surface or table, do not hang power cord over the
edge of table or counter.
Ensure the power cord do not touch hot surface of appliance.
Do not place the coffee maker on hot surface or beside fire in order to avoid
to be damaged.
To disconnect, tum any control to"off, " then remove plug from wall outlet.
Always hold the plug. But never pull the cord.
Do not use appliance for other than intended use and place it in a dry
environment.
Close supervision is necessary when your appliance is being used by or near
children.
Be careful not to get burned by the steam.
